[0041] Such as figure 1As shown, the present invention is based on a light-temperature coupling solar greenhouse rolling machine control method. According to the light intensity required for the plant growth stage, the light intensity threshold is set; the real-time light intensity outside the greenhouse is detected and judged by comparing with the threshold. If the light intensity is required, it is judged that the roller shutter can be opened; if the ambient light intensity is less than the set light intensity threshold, it is judged that the roller shutter is closed or the roller shutter is not opened to keep the original state.
